To arrive at the amount of fuel which he would need to request from the fuelers, he needed to subtract the amount already in the tanks from the total of 22,300 kg. The reference to MEL 28412 invoked the relevant chapter of the planes Minimum Equipment List, or MEL a document kept aboard the aircraft which lists the systems which must be operable in order to depart, and provides instructions for additional safety measures to be taken when certain systems are not working. In Lockwoods view, the plane ran out of fuel because three layers of redundant safety features all failed, one after another: first the fuel gauges, then the requirement not to dispatch without working fuel gauges, and finally the direct check of the fuel quantity, prescribed by the MEL. Two factors helped avert disaster: the failure of the front landing gear to lock into position during the gravity drop, and the presence of a guardrail that had been installed along the centre of the repurposed runway to facilitate its use as a dragrace track. The situation would have been even worse were it not for the deployment of the Ram Air Turbine, or RAT, a small propeller which, in the event of a dual engine failure, automatically drops into the airstream below the plane, where it generates power to keep the hydraulic pumps running. In 1983, there was no prescribed procedure for flying and landing without any engines. The result was that by 1983 pilots usually didnt know how most systems worked from an engineering perspective, especially with regard to avionics.
